CLEMENTS, Bill
THE FATAL FORTRESS: The Guns and Fortifications of Singapore 1819 - 1956
Barnsley: Pen & Sword Military 2016. Traces the history of Singapore's fortifications and guns from the city's foundation in 1819 to the demise of coastal artillery in the British Army in 1953. It also follows the development of artillery through the Victorian era of muzzle-loading guns to the introduction of the large breech-loading guns of the twentieth century. 199 pages vii prelims. CLERK (John)
An Essay on Naval Tactics, Systematical and Historical. With Explanatory Plates.
Second edition, 4to (270 x 210 mm), [6], xv, [1], [5]-287, [1]pp., 52 partially coloured engraved plates of naval manoeuvres, some light foxing and offsetting, cont. half calf Richardson of Newcastle, with their binder's ticket, marbled boards, rubbed, joints starting but holding firm. First published in four parts between 1790 and 1797 this was "one of the first British account of tactics, as opposed to a work in French translation, and for its criticism of the current Royal Naval practice of looking more to signal books to the detriment of fighting instructions."?(ODNB). Cleworth, Robert; Linton, John Suter.
RAAF Black Cats. The Secret History of the Covert Catalina Mine-Laying Operations to Cripple Japan's War Machine.
Sydney: Allen & Unwin Australia 2019. xxv 262pp index bibliography notes glossary appendices bw ills maps. Pictorial card. Small crease to top rear corner otherwise near new. The story of a covert Australian airborne mine-laying operation in cooperation with the US Seventh Fleet to disrupt Japanese supply routes unearthing the sacrifice and achievements of the RAAF Catalina crews and the vital role they played in MacArthur's strategic plan for the south-west Pacific. .
